在这个数字化时代,小程序作为一种轻量级的应用程序,越来越受到大众的喜爱。对于初学者来说,掌握一个小程序框架,不仅能让你体验到编程的乐趣,还能帮助你拓宽知识面,为未来的职业发展打下坚实基础。本文将带你从入门到精通,通过实战案例解析,开启你的编程之旅。
一、小程序框架概述
1.1 什么是小程序?
小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或者搜一下即可打开应用。小程序不需要下载安装,也不需要卸载,方便快捷。
1.2 小程序框架简介
目前,主流的小程序框架包括微信小程序、支付宝小程序、百度小程序等。这些框架都提供了一套完整的小程序开发环境,包括API接口、组件库、开发工具等,方便开发者快速上手。
二、入门篇
2.1 选择合适的小程序框架
对于初学者来说,选择一个合适的小程序框架至关重要。以下是一些选择建议:
- 微信小程序:作为目前最流行的小程序平台,拥有庞大的用户群体,学习资源丰富。
- 支付宝小程序:适合电商领域,与支付宝用户群体高度契合。
- 百度小程序:适合内容创作领域,与百度搜索、百度地图等紧密结合。
2.2 学习基础知识
学习小程序框架前,需要掌握以下基础知识:
- HTML、CSS、JavaScript:这些是网页开发的基础语言,对于小程序开发同样适用。
- 常见编程规范:如代码风格、命名规范等。
2.3 安装开发工具
不同的小程序框架需要不同的开发工具。以下是一些常见框架的开发工具:
- 微信小程序:微信开发者工具
- 支付宝小程序:蚂蚁开发者工具
- 百度小程序:百度开发者工具
三、进阶篇
3.1 深入了解框架API
熟练掌握框架提供的API是开发小程序的关键。以下是一些常用API:
- 数据绑定:实现视图与数据的同步。
- 事件绑定:实现用户交互。
- 页面路由:实现页面跳转。
3.2 组件开发
组件是小程序开发的基础。学习如何创建和使用自定义组件,有助于提高开发效率。
3.3 优化性能
性能优化是小程序开发中的重要环节。以下是一些优化技巧:
- 图片优化:压缩图片大小,减少加载时间。
- 代码优化:优化代码结构,提高运行效率。
四、实战案例解析
4.1 案例一:制作一个简单的待办事项列表
通过这个案例,你将学习如何使用小程序框架创建一个待办事项列表,并实现添加、删除、完成等功能。
4.2 案例二:开发一个简单的电商小程序
在这个案例中,你将学习如何使用小程序框架开发一个简单的电商小程序,包括商品展示、购物车、订单管理等模块。
4.3 案例三:实现小程序与后端服务的交互
通过这个案例,你将学习如何使用小程序框架实现小程序与后端服务的交互,如登录、注册、获取数据等。
五、总结
掌握小程序框架,开启你的编程之旅。从入门到精通,通过不断学习和实践,相信你将在这个领域取得优异成绩。祝你在编程的道路上越走越远!
